New Cast Members Join the Ensemble
With the return of the original cast, fans will also be excited by the addition of new faces. Leighton Meester, known for her role as Blair Waldorf in ‘Gossip Girl,’ steps into a significant new role as Joanne’s high school nemesis turned momfluencer. This dynamic character is set to bring both conflict and comic relief to the series.
Another notable addition is Arian Moayed as Dr.
Andy, a charming and potentially romantic figure for Noah’s sister Morgan. Alex Karpovsky will portray an overly competitive rabbi in Noah’s synagogue, adding another layer of tension to the narrative. Seth Rogen makes a guest appearance as Rabbi Neil, further enriching the religious landscape of the show.
Joanne’s Conversion and the Future
A central subplot for Season 2 revolves around Joanne’s decision to convert to Judaism. This choice is not driven by spiritual awakening but rather a desire to stay with Noah. The second season will explore the implications of this decision, both for Joanne personally and for her relationship with Noah. As they grapple with the practicalities and symbolic meanings of conversion, viewers can expect heartfelt discussions on faith, identity, and commitment.
